Liverpool boss Jurgen Klopp gives Diogo Jota verdict as forward signs new contract

Jurgen Klopp has given his reaction following Diogo Jota’s decision to put pen to paper on a new Liverpool contract.

The Portugal international will remain at Anfield until the summer of 2027 as he looks to claim more silverware under the stewardship of Klopp. 

The German manager signed Jota from Wolverhampton back in 2020, with Liverpool splashing £41 on his signature.
Since arriving at Merseyside, the forward has scored 34 goals in 85 games across all competitions.
The 25-year-old has claimed three trophies with the Reds, including the FA Cup, League Cup and Community Shield. He was also part of the team which came up short in last year's Champions League final against Real Madrid.

Reacting to Jota's new deal, Klopp told Liverpoolfc.com: "What Diogo has brought to this team and this club since he arrived is there for all to see, so it is really good news that he has signed a new contract. Brilliant, brilliant news, I would say.

"His qualities are obvious. He scores goals - not a bad quality - he works unbelievably hard for the team, his pressing and counter-pressing are on an unbelievable level, he can play in all of our attacking roles and he has an incredible attitude. Not a bad package. Not bad at all.
"As a striker who can play on the wing, he gives us so many options and since he came to Liverpool he has improved so much.
"I have said before that Diogo is the player we hoped he would be but also a little bit better, so long may this continue."
